Job description

Veterinary Technician

Big Dog Ranch Rescue(“BDRR”) is a one-of-a-kind dog rescue facility located in Loxahatchee Groves, Florida. We are seeking an experienced Full-Time Veterinary Technician able to multitask in a high paced environment. Must be a team player and willing to learn new things with an open mind. Compensation based on experience.

Duties and Responsibilities

  • Must be able to place IV catheters, intubate, draw blood from legs and jugular.
  • Collect and perform analysis of fecal samples,
  • Surgical site preparation and monitor surgeries,
  • Set up and read heartworm, and parvo tests.
  • Ability to give intramuscular, subcutaneous injections.
  • Working knowledge of X-Ray and ultrasound machines.
  • Give oral medications.
  • Properly restrain dogs.

Requirements and Qualifications

  • 2-5 years of experience
  • Certification a plus but NOT required.
  • Must be dependable with attendance and timeliness.
  • Must be able to work at least one weekend day.
  • Provide compassionate care.
  • Ability to work with staff at all levels.
  • Ability to work under pressure and plan personal workload effectively.
  • Veterinary experience with an animal rescue, shelter, a plus

Company Description

Big Dog Ranch Rescue is a one-of-a-kind dog rescue facility located in Loxahatchee Groves, Florida. Saving 5,000 lives annually and 50,000 lives to date, Big Dog Ranch Rescue is committed to rescuing, rehabilitating, and finding homes for dogs of all sizes and breeds. With our Veteran Dog Training and Seniors for Seniors programs, we are committed to all dogs and the people who love them.
